The EasyPay Group consists of 4 companies already well known both on the local market and in Europe and Africa as a self-service solutions provider, with over 12 years of experience and a steady growth trajectory, led by Mr. Serghei Fraseniuc and a close-knit team with shared goals.

Serghei Fraseniuc on the parent company, EasyPay System:
We founded it in April 2010, when we started out with the first payment terminal implemented on the Romanian market as an agent, and today we manage a network of over 1,000 payment terminals with more than 180 integrated services, including: PaySafeCard and OctoPay-related services well known in the gambling market, Prepay card top-ups, taxes and duties, CFR tickets or event tickets, taxi and delivery account management, gaming licenses, etc. Payment terminals are now present in all super- and mini-market chains, on the street, in parking lots, and even in gambling areas.

As for the production of self-service kiosks, this is carried out through EasyPay Production, which generates sales of 4,000 kiosks annually, the main products being payment terminals and sports betting terminals, and secondarily we have developed and implemented solutions for areas such as: HoReCa, Parking, Public Transport, Crypto, Insurance, and many others.
All terminals marketed by EasyPay benefit from CE Certificate, ISO 9001:2015 Certification, and all European quality standards.

At group level, through strategic partnerships, a series of self-service solutions have been implemented that make the activities of companies easier, such as:
Easy Coin to Card – a terminal associated with a store that receives, counts, and sorts coins, converting them into a voucher that can be used to pay for purchased products.
Easy HoReCa – a terminal used to order food products, with payment by POS or cash, without coming into contact with restaurant staff, whether classic or fast food.
Easy Crypto – a terminal developed for buying and selling cryptocurrencies, available to users 24/7, very often also associated with gambling locations.
Easy Transport – a terminal implemented in stations for purchasing tickets or subscriptions for public transport.
Easy Parking – a terminal for paying for public or private parking.
Easy Fitness – a terminal for purchasing subscriptions and for access to sports halls.
Easy Info Kiosk – intended for all types of locations, both public and private, whether for informing clients, guiding them, electronic queueing, or interactive map.

As expected, for the support of terminals implemented in the market, both for our own networks and those of clients, Easy Technix supports the warranty and post-warranty period with maintenance and repair services performed in-house, as well as software integration at the clients’ request.
